Overview Medical Behavioral Hospital of Clear Lake is expanding its clinical services team with additional therapists to deliver exceptional care to our patients and their families throughout their recovery journey. The therapist will provide daily individual and group counseling along with best‑in‑class treatment planning and care coordination under the guidance of the Director of Clinical Services. Therapists are master’s‑prepared clinicians with a focus on trauma‑informed care, compassion, and patient safety.

Responsibilities
Accountable for overall treatment planning efforts, care conferences with families and providers, family and provider care updates, psychosocial needs and completion.
Coordinate and facilitate the development of a discharge plan of care for the patient population which includes accountability for the complex discharge process.
Ensure the experience of care for the patient and family is exceptional.
Qualifications
Education: Master’s in Social Work (MSW), Counseling, Psychology, or related human services field is required.
LCSW, LPC, or LMHC provisionally licensed is preferred.
Minimum of 2 years of clinical experience in a behavioral healthcare or acute psychiatric setting preferred.
Previous experience in an acute inpatient behavioral health hospital a plus.
Experience developing and administering treatment plans.
Individual and group counseling techniques.
Exceptional communication skills.
